NLP: Natural Language Processing with R Schulung
Schätzungen zufolge machen unstrukturierte Daten mehr als 90 Prozent aller Daten aus, viele davon in Form von Text. Blogbeiträge, Tweets, soziale Medien und andere digitale Veröffentlichungen tragen kontinuierlich zu dieser wachsenden Datenmenge bei.
In diesem Live-Kurs, der von einem Dozenten geleitet wird, geht es darum, Erkenntnisse und Bedeutung aus diesen Daten zu extrahieren. Unter Verwendung der R Language- und Natural Language Processing (NLP)-Bibliotheken kombinieren wir Konzepte und Techniken aus der Informatik, der künstlichen Intelligenz und der Computerlinguistik, um die Bedeutung hinter Textdaten algorithmisch zu verstehen. Datenbeispiele sind je nach Kundenanforderung in verschiedenen Sprachen verfügbar.
Am Ende dieser Schulung werden die Teilnehmer in der Lage sein, Datensätze (große und kleine) aus unterschiedlichen Quellen vorzubereiten und dann die richtigen Algorithmen anzuwenden, um die Bedeutung zu analysieren und zu berichten.
Format des Kurses
- Teilweise Vortrag, teilweise Diskussion, viel praktische Übung, gelegentliche Tests zur Überprüfung des Verständnisses
Schulungsübersicht
Einführung
- NLP und R gegenüber Python
Installieren und Konfigurieren von R Studio
Installieren von R-Paketen mit Bezug zu Natural Language Processing (NLP)
Ein Überblick über die Textmanipulationsfähigkeiten von R
Erste Schritte mit einem NLP-Projekt in R
Lesen und Importieren von Datendateien in R
Textmanipulation mit R
Dokument-Clustering in R
Tagging von Wortteilen in R
Satz-Parsing in R
Arbeiten mit regulären Expressionen in R
Named-Entity-Erkennung in R
Modellierung von Themen in R
Text-Klassifikation in R
Arbeiten mit sehr großen Datensätzen
Visualisierung Ihrer Ergebnisse
Optimierung
Integration von R mit anderen Languages (Java, Python, etc.)
Zusammenfassung und Schlussfolgerung
Voraussetzungen
- Eine gewisse Vertrautheit mit der Programmierung.
Zielgruppe
- Linguisten und Programmierer
Offene Schulungskurse erfordern mindestens 5 Teilnehmer.
NLP: Natural Language Processing with R Schulung - Booking
NLP: Natural Language Processing with R Schulung - Enquiry
NLP: Natural Language Processing with R - Beratungsanfrage
Beratungsanfrage
Erfahrungsberichte (1)
The pace was just right and the relaxed atmosphere made candidates feel at ease to ask questions.
Rhian Hughes - Public Health Wales NHS Trust
Kurs - Introduction to Data Visualization with Tidyverse and R
Kommende Kurse
Kombinierte Kurse
Introduction to Data Visualization with Tidyverse and R
7 StundenDas Tidyverse ist eine Sammlung vielseitiger R-Pakete zum Reinigen, Verarbeiten, Modellieren und Visualisieren von Daten. Einige der enthaltenen Pakete sind: ggplot2, dplyr, tidyr, readr, purrr und tibble.
In diesem von Lehrern geleiteten Live-Training lernen die Teilnehmer, wie sie Daten mit den im Tidyverse enthaltenen Tools Tidyverse und visualisieren.
Am Ende dieser Schulung können die Teilnehmer:
- Führen Sie eine Datenanalyse durch und erstellen Sie ansprechende Visualisierungen
- Ziehen Sie nützliche Schlussfolgerungen aus verschiedenen Datensätzen von Beispieldaten
- Filtern, sortieren und fassen Sie Daten zusammen, um Erkundungsfragen zu beantworten
- Wandeln Sie verarbeitete Daten in informative Liniendiagramme, Balkendiagramme und Histogramme um
- Importieren und filtern Sie Daten aus verschiedenen Datenquellen, einschließlich Excel , CSV- und SPSS-Dateien
Publikum
- Anfänger in die R-Sprache
- Einsteiger in die Datenanalyse und Datenvisualisierung
Format des Kurses
- Teilvorlesung, Teildiskussion, Übungen und viel praktisches Üben
AI Automation with n8n and LangChain
14 StundenDiese von einem Trainer geleitete Live-Schulung in Schweiz (online oder vor Ort) richtet sich an Entwickler und IT-Fachleute aller Qualifikationsstufen, die Aufgaben und Prozesse mithilfe von KI automatisieren möchten, ohne umfangreichen Code zu schreiben.
Am Ende dieser Schulung werden die Teilnehmer in der Lage sein:
- Komplexe Workflows mit der visuellen Programmierschnittstelle von n8n zu entwerfen und zu implementieren.
- KI-Funktionen mithilfe von LangChain in Workflows zu integrieren.
- Individuelle Chatbots und virtuelle Assistenten für verschiedene Anwendungsfälle zu erstellen.
- Erweiterte Datenanalyse und -verarbeitung mit KI-Agenten durchführen.
Automating Workflows with LangChain and APIs
14 StundenDiese Live-Schulung in Schweiz (online oder vor Ort) unter der Leitung eines Trainers richtet sich an Anfänger im Bereich der Geschäftsanalytik und Automatisierungsingenieure, die verstehen möchten, wie man LangChain und APIs für die Automatisierung von sich wiederholenden Aufgaben und Arbeitsabläufen verwendet.
Am Ende dieses Kurses werden die Teilnehmer in der Lage sein
- Die Grundlagen der API-Integration mit LangChain zu verstehen.
- Sich wiederholende Arbeitsabläufe mit LangChain und Python zu automatisieren.
- Nutzung von LangChain zur Verbindung verschiedener APIs für effiziente Geschäftsprozesse.
- Benutzerdefinierte Workflows mithilfe von APIs und den Automatisierungsfunktionen von LangChain erstellen und automatisieren.
Building Conversational Agents with LangChain
14 StundenDiese von einem Trainer geleitete Live-Schulung in Schweiz (online oder vor Ort) richtet sich an Fachleute auf mittlerem Niveau, die ihr Verständnis von Conversational Agents vertiefen und LangChain auf reale Anwendungsfälle anwenden möchten.
Am Ende dieser Schulung werden die Teilnehmer in der Lage sein:
- Die Grundlagen von LangChain und seine Anwendung bei der Entwicklung von Conversational Agents zu verstehen.
- Konversationsagenten mit LangChain entwickeln und einsetzen.
- Konversationsagenten mit APIs und externen Diensten zu integrieren.
- Anwendung von Natural Language Processing (NLP)-Techniken zur Verbesserung der Leistung von Conversational Agents.
Ethical Considerations in AI Development with LangChain
21 StundenDiese von einem Dozenten geleitete Live-Schulung in Schweiz (online oder vor Ort) richtet sich an fortgeschrittene KI-Forscher und politische Entscheidungsträger, die sich mit den ethischen Auswirkungen der KI-Entwicklung befassen und lernen möchten, wie sie ethische Richtlinien bei der Entwicklung von KI-Lösungen mit LangChain anwenden können.
Am Ende dieses Kurses werden die Teilnehmer in der Lage sein:
- Die wichtigsten ethischen Fragen bei der KI-Entwicklung mit LangChain zu identifizieren.
- Die Auswirkungen von KI auf die Gesellschaft und Entscheidungsprozesse zu verstehen.
- Strategien für den Aufbau fairer und transparenter KI-Systeme zu entwickeln.
- Ethische KI-Richtlinien in LangChain-basierte Projekte zu implementieren.
Enhancing User Experience with LangChain in Web Apps
14 StundenDiese Live-Schulung in Schweiz (online oder vor Ort) richtet sich an fortgeschrittene Webentwickler und UX-Designer, die LangChain nutzen möchten, um intuitive und benutzerfreundliche Webanwendungen zu erstellen.
Am Ende dieser Schulung werden die Teilnehmer in der Lage sein:
- Die grundlegenden Konzepte von LangChain und ihre Rolle bei der Verbesserung der Web-Benutzererfahrung zu verstehen.
- Implementierung von LangChain in Webanwendungen, um dynamische und reaktionsschnelle Schnittstellen zu schaffen.
- APIs in Webanwendungen zu integrieren, um die Interaktivität und das Engagement der Benutzer zu verbessern.
- Optimieren Sie die Benutzererfahrung mit den erweiterten Anpassungsfunktionen von LangChain.
- Analysieren Sie Daten zum Benutzerverhalten, um die Leistung und das Erlebnis von Webanwendungen zu optimieren.
LangChain: Building AI-Powered Applications
14 StundenDiese Live-Schulung in Schweiz (online oder vor Ort) richtet sich an fortgeschrittene Entwickler und Softwareingenieure, die KI-gestützte Anwendungen mit dem LangChain-Framework erstellen möchten.
Am Ende dieser Schulung werden die Teilnehmer in der Lage sein:
- Die Grundlagen von LangChain und seinen Komponenten zu verstehen.
- LangChain mit großen Sprachmodellen (LLMs) wie GPT-4 zu integrieren.
- Modulare KI-Anwendungen mit LangChain zu erstellen.
- Häufige Probleme in LangChain-Anwendungen zu beheben.
Integrating LangChain with Cloud Services
14 StundenDiese von einem Trainer geleitete Live-Schulung in Schweiz (online oder vor Ort) richtet sich an fortgeschrittene Dateningenieure und DevOps-Fachleute, die die Fähigkeiten von LangChain durch Integration mit verschiedenen Cloud-Diensten nutzen möchten.
Am Ende dieser Schulung werden die Teilnehmer in der Lage sein,:
- Integration von LangChain mit wichtigen Cloud-Plattformen wie AWS, Azure und Google Cloud.
- Cloud-basierte APIs und Dienste zu nutzen, um LangChain-gestützte Anwendungen zu verbessern.
- Skalierung und Bereitstellung von Conversational Agents in der Cloud für Echtzeit-Interaktionen.
- Implementierung von Best Practices für Überwachung und Sicherheit in Cloud-Umgebungen.
LangChain for Data Analysis and Visualization
14 StundenDiese Live-Schulung in Schweiz (online oder vor Ort) richtet sich an fortgeschrittene Datenexperten, die mit LangChain ihre Fähigkeiten zur Datenanalyse und -visualisierung verbessern möchten.
Am Ende dieser Schulung werden die Teilnehmer in der Lage sein:
- Datenabfrage und -bereinigung mit LangChain zu automatisieren.
- Fortgeschrittene Datenanalyse mit Python und LangChain durchführen.
- Visualisierungen mit Matplotlib und anderen in LangChain integrierten Python-Bibliotheken zu erstellen.
- Nutzung von LangChain zur Generierung von natürlichsprachlichen Erkenntnissen aus der Datenanalyse.
LangChain Fundamentals
14 StundenDiese Live-Schulung in Schweiz (online oder vor Ort) richtet sich an Anfänger und fortgeschrittene Entwickler und Software-Ingenieure, die die Kernkonzepte und die Architektur von LangChain kennenlernen und praktische Fähigkeiten zur Erstellung von KI-gestützten Anwendungen erwerben möchten.
Am Ende dieses Kurses werden die Teilnehmer in der Lage sein:
- Die Grundprinzipien von LangChain zu verstehen.
- Die LangChain-Umgebung einzurichten und zu konfigurieren.
- die Architektur und das Zusammenspiel von LangChain mit großen Sprachmodellen (LLMs) zu verstehen.
- Einfache Anwendungen mit LangChain zu entwickeln.
Advanced Techniques in Natural Language Generation (NLG)
14 StundenDiese Live-Schulung in Schweiz (online oder vor Ort) richtet sich an Fachleute auf mittlerem Niveau, die ihre Fähigkeiten zur Erstellung hochwertiger, menschenähnlicher Texte mit fortgeschrittenen NLG-Methoden verbessern möchten.
Am Ende dieses Kurses werden die Teilnehmer in der Lage sein:
- fortgeschrittene Techniken zur Generierung natürlichsprachlicher Texte zu verstehen.
- Transformator-basierte Modelle für NLG zu implementieren und fein abzustimmen.
- NLG-Ausgaben auf Flüssigkeit, Kohärenz und Relevanz zu optimieren.
- die Qualität des generierten Textes mit Hilfe automatischer und menschlicher Metriken zu bewerten.
Introduction to Natural Language Generation (NLG)
14 StundenDiese von einem Trainer geleitete Live-Schulung in Schweiz (online oder vor Ort) richtet sich an Einsteiger, die die Grundlagen der NLG und ihre Rolle in der KI und Inhaltserstellung erlernen möchten.
Am Ende dieser Schulung werden die Teilnehmer in der Lage sein:
- die grundlegenden Konzepte der natürlichen Sprachgenerierung zu verstehen.
- die Anwendungen von NLG in verschiedenen Branchen zu erkunden.
- Grundlegende Techniken zur Erzeugung von menschenähnlichem Text mit Hilfe von KI erlernen.
- Mit Python-Bibliotheken und -Modellen arbeiten, um Text zu generieren.
Python for Natural Language Generation (NLG)
21 StundenIn this instructor-led, live training in Schweiz, participants will learn how to use Python to produce high-quality natural language text by building their own NLG system from scratch. Case studies will also be examined and the relevant concepts will be applied to live lab projects for generating content.
By the end of this training, participants will be able to:
- Use NLG to automatically generate content for various industries, from journalism, to real estate, to weather and sports reporting.
- Select and organize source content, plan sentences, and prepare a system for automatic generation of original content.
- Understand the NLG pipeline and apply the right techniques at each stage.
- Understand the architecture of a Natural Language Generation (NLG) system.
- Implement the most suitable algorithms and models for analysis and ordering.
- Pull data from publicly available data sources as well as curated databases to use as material for generated text.
- Replace manual and laborious writing processes with computer-generated, automated content creation.
AI-Driven NLG for Chatbots and Virtual Assistants
21 StundenDiese Live-Schulung in Schweiz (online oder vor Ort) richtet sich an fortgeschrittene Fachleute, die KI-gesteuerte NLG-Techniken für Chatbot- und virtuelle Assistenzanwendungen beherrschen möchten.
Am Ende dieser Schulung werden die Teilnehmer in der Lage sein:
- Die Kernprinzipien von NLG für konversationelle KI zu verstehen.
- Einsatz von Deep Learning-Techniken zur Verbesserung der Chatbot-Dialoggenerierung.
- Modernste NLG-Modelle wie GPT-3 in Chatbot-Frameworks zu integrieren.
- kontextbezogene KI zur Verbesserung der Kohärenz und Flüssigkeit von Gesprächen anzuwenden.
Text Summarization and Content Generation with AI (NLG)
21 StundenDiese Live-Schulung in Schweiz (online oder vor Ort) richtet sich an Fachleute auf mittlerem Niveau, die praktische Fertigkeiten in der Verwendung von NLG zur Automatisierung von Textzusammenfassungen und Inhaltserstellung erwerben möchten.
Am Ende dieser Schulung werden die Teilnehmer in der Lage sein:
- Die Kernprinzipien von NLG für die Textzusammenfassung und Inhaltserstellung zu verstehen.
- NLG-Modelle zu implementieren, um große Dokumente und Artikel zusammenzufassen.
- Vorgefertigte NLG-Modelle wie GPT für die Inhaltserstellung zu nutzen.
- fortgeschrittene Techniken zur Feinabstimmung von NLG-Modellen für spezifische Aufgaben der Inhaltserstellung anzuwenden.